New Delhi: Spain has initiated the method to exchange its Ambassador to India, Juan Antonio March Pujol, within the wake of studies pointing to potential violation of protocol, misuse of public funds and improper monetary dealings. The transfer follows a report submitted by Spain’s Overseas Ministry to the nation’s Anti-Corruption Prosecutor’s Workplace in Might, as reported by the Spanish digital information outlet The Goal.
The studies in Spanish media don’t, nonetheless, set up that the allegations towards the ambassador have been confirmed.
In accordance with The Goal, the ambassador allegedly sought help from numerous Spanish firms based mostly in India in addition to the federal government of Rajasthan to advertise artists who weren’t Spanish. These sponsorships, it stated, have been sought with out informing the Spanish international ministry, and the concert events have been to be organised with out leaving any report within the accounts of the Embassy in India.
The artists, the report stated, have been commissioned to carry out at cultural concert events as a part of the Spain-India Twin 12 months that coincided with the ambassador’s birthday. These concert events have been finally vetoed by the Spanish Company for Worldwide Growth Cooperation (AECID). These commissioned to carry out included a neighborhood dance firm, STEM Dance Kampani, Spanish tenor Joan Laínez and Chinese language tenor Huiling Zhu.
It goes additional so as to add that Huiling, the Chinese language mezzo-soprano, “was rumored to have a romantic relationship with the ambassador”.
“This artist, who will not be Spanish, obtained €18,000 from the cultural finances of this embassy,” in response to the report. The ambassador justified in search of authorisation to be used of public funds to fee her concert events in 2025 by arguing that her “musical repertoire consisted largely of Spanish lyric songs”. However Huiling’s biography, in response to The Goal, doesn’t point out any Spanish music.
The ambassador can also be alleged to have reached a private settlement with BLS, an Indian firm chargeable for processing Spanish visa purposes, underneath which the corporate would contribute 5,000 euros towards a cultural occasion in Rajasthan.
BLS handles outsourced visa-processing companies for the Spanish Embassy in India, in addition to for different Spanish missions all over the world.
Alfredo Martínez Serrano, Spain’s ambassador to Canada, is predicted to take cost in New Delhi. As soon as India grants its approval, the formal handover on the Spanish Embassy in New Delhi is predicted to happen inside the subsequent few weeks.
March, in response to The Goal, noticed New Delhi as his final posting earlier than his retirement in February 2028 when he would flip 70.
The report additionally stated that after taking over his submit in New Delhi, March inaugurated the Indo-Spanish Movie and Cultural Discussion board at Marwah Movie Studios, led by Sandeep Marwah, president of the Worldwide Chamber of Media and Leisure Industries (ICMEI), in “partnership with the Spanish Embassy,” with March named its “patron”. The connection later prolonged to March’s daughter, Milena March Franzi. Final July, Marwah hosted her for a workshop on “model administration” on the Asian Academy of Movie and Tv, an occasion promoted by ICMEI and that includes pictures of her with the ambassador.
In accordance with The Goal, Milena holds a diplomatic passport issued by Spain’s international ministry, which has facilitated her skilled actions in India alongside her father.
“They’ve established an organization to introduce companies to India. Milena attends personal occasions in embassy automobiles and lives within the residence whereas doing enterprise for her father. “She’s his entrance,” a former ambassador instructed the publication, terming the newest developments an “unprecedented scandal” .
Spain’s Council of Ministers had accepted the appointment of Juan Antonio March Pujol as ambassador to India in early 2024. He assumed the function in September that 12 months, after having been on go away from the Spanish international ministry for greater than a decade. On the time, The Diplomat in Spain had described the delay as “an unusually lengthy interval” between two international locations that maintained no identified bilateral disagreement.
The Spanish authorities had sought India’s approval to nominate him as ambassador after the earlier ambassador, José María Ridao, requested in December 2023 that Overseas Minister José Manuel Albares enable him to go away the submit in New Delhi. Ridao was appointed Ambassador to India in July 2021.
March was thought of near former Spanish prime minister José Luis Rodríguez Zapatero and former international minister Miguel Ángel Moratinos. In accordance with The Diplomat in Spain, Moratinos had apparently taken up the difficulty of the delay within the approval for March’s appointment with Indian authorities.

Barceló Dome controversy
Earlier than India, Juan Antonio March Pujol’s final diplomatic posting was as Spain’s ambassador to Russia, the place he served from 2007 till the top of 2011. March was additionally stationed in Geneva, the place he served as Spain’s Everlasting Consultant to the United Nations and Ambassador to the World Commerce Group (WTO) between 2004 and 2007.
It was throughout his time on the United Nations that he turned carefully related to certainly one of Spain’s most formidable cultural tasks.
With the help of then-foreign minister Moratinos, March offered to the United Nations a proposal to renovate Room XX of the Palace of Nations in Geneva. The room was subsequently renamed the “Human Rights Chamber”.
Below the unique proposal, Madrid would bear 30 p.c of the associated fee, whereas the rest would come from personal contributions. The Spanish authorities subsequently budgeted €16.6 million for the development of the Dome by Spanish painter Miquel Barceló. The ultimate value of the fee, nonetheless, exceeded €20 million.
The challenge turned controversial, together with over the allocation of €500,000 from the Growth Help Fund, or FAD.
The Spanish authorities sought to justify that expenditure by arguing that the work was meant to advertise human rights and multilateralism.
In 2017, Ramón Álvarez de Miranda, then president of Spain’s Courtroom of Accounts, raised questions in regards to the state’s contribution to the challenge earlier than the Congress of Deputies.
The Barceló Dome was ultimately inaugurated in 2008, virtually a 12 months later than initially scheduled. The ceremony was attended by King Juan Carlos and Queen Sofía, Prime Minister José Luis Rodríguez Zapatero, United Nations Secretary Common Ban Ki-moon and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an, who was then prime minister. Zapatero’s authorities was on the time selling the Alliance of Civilisations alongside Erdogan.
March attended the inauguration as vp of the ONUART Basis, a place he held alongside his submit as Spain’s Ambassador to Russia.
